Today in the Senate

February 9, 2012:

The Senate will convene at 9:30 a.m. on Thursday.  Following any Leader remarks, the Senate will be in morning business until 11:00 a.m. with Senators permitted to speak therein for up to 10 minutes each with the Majority controlling the first half and the Republicans controlling the final half.

Following morning business, the Senate will resume consideration of the motion to proceed to S. 1813, the Surface Transportation bill.

At approximately 2:00 p.m., there will be a roll call vote on the motion to invoke cloture on the motion to proceed to S. 1813.

 

 

ABOUT TIM: TIM'S COMMITTEES

Tim listens to testimony during a Banking Committee hearing

Appropriations Committee

The Senate Appropriations Committee, the largest committee in the Senate, writes the legislation that allocates federal funds to the numerous government agencies, departments, and organizations on an annual basis. Senator Daniel K. Inouye (D-HI) is chairman of the committee.

Banking, Housing, and Urban Affairs Committee

The Banking, Housing, and Urban Affairs Committee deals with legislation on multiple topics, including banks and financial institutions, public and private housing, urban development and urban mass transit and the renegotiation of Government contracts. Senator Chris Dodd (D-CT) is the committee chairman.

Energy and Natural Resources Committee

The committee oversees issues dealing with energy resources and development, including regulation, conservation, strategic petroleum reserves and appliance standards; nuclear energy; Indian affairs; public lands and their renewable resources; surface mining, Federal coal, oil, and gas, other mineral leasing; territories and insular possessions; and water resources. Currently, Senator Jeff Bingaman (D-NM) chairs the committee.

Indian Affairs Committee

The Indian Affairs Committee deals with issues pertaining to the nation's Native American population. North Dakota Senator Senator Byron Dorgan chairs the committee.
